Looky ~ looky! I am so excited about this! Okay so you know I am a new Stampin Up! demonstrator. Well I am not one that already has a collection of SU ink pads. I had previously really only had Close To My Heart ink pads, which I loved the way that I stored them and kept them so handy with the Ikea shower caddy's and towel bars. Now switching over to having SU ink pads, well...they don't fit the same way! And I don't really want a bulky ink pad tower on my desk. So look what I came up with!! It's the same Ikea shower caddy's I just turned them on their side! They still can hang from the towel bars and then I just (get this!!) twist tied the two caddy's together and just hung the top one from the towel bar. he he he! Each caddy can easily hold 8-10 ink pads, although keeping it to 8 is much more accessible. And I can just keep adding extra caddy's as my collection of ink pads increases. The caddy's are $1.99 and so is the towel bar. Pretty cheap!


In this picture you can really see the difference in how the two types of ink pads store in these caddy's. Also you can see that I keep my scrubber and spray handy in the top tray. My sponges are right next to that in the white hanging bowl. And next to the SU ink pads are my clear blocks. Everything within reach, in view and so accessible for all my stamping projects. You can see too that I hang my heat gun on a hook here and it is always ready when I need it. I LOVE having all my punches up now and I can see all of them in one place.


In the bottom right hand side cubby I use this large accordion file to store all my scrap paper. I love this system. It is organized just by color, so whenever I need a piece of red paper I can just go through that first before I start cutting anymore full sheets. Especially when I just need a bit of paper for a punch, it's really nice to have that handy. Also in that big green box is all my 'stuff' that I use with my Cuttlebug. Keeps everything within reach.

My Shop Space


Today I thought I'd share what I think is a pretty great idea for my little shop space at home. On the wall behind our front door I hung up a vinyl window cling as my shop 'sign' and then I used some IKEA towel racks, the same ones many of us use for our punches. With the help of some hooks and the coordinating baskets, I can hang all my cards and display my journals and card sets. All of it is so reasonably priced as well, the towel racks are $1.99, the hooks are .99 for a pack of 10 and then the baskets I think are $3 or 4. Right now I have about 50 cards hanging plus the 3 baskets, and everything is easily accessible.
